South Meadow Gulch
South Meadow Gulch is a valley in Tehama County, Shasta Cascades, California and has an elevation of 981 feet. South Meadow Gulch is situated nearby to the area Widow Wilson Field, as well as near the hamlet Alford Place.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Rosewood
Hamlet
Rosewood is an unincorporated community in Tehama County, California, United States. Rosewood is situated along State Route 36 at the junction with County Route A5 to Cottonwood. Rosewood is situated 5 miles east of South Meadow Gulch.
